现代企业正面临数字身份前所未有的激增,机器身份已显著超过人类身份。本文研究了“人机身份模糊”带来的新型网络安全风险——即人与机器身份在授权交叠、权限委托中形成的新攻击面。基于行业数据、专家意见和真实事件分析,发现现有身份管理模型将人与机器分隔处理存在治理漏洞。为此提出统一身份治理框架,包含四大原则:将身份视为连续体而非二元对立;对所有身份类型应用一致的风险评估;基于零信任实施持续验证;贯穿全生命周期的治理。研究显示,采用该框架的组织可降低47%的身份相关安全事件,事件响应时间提升62%。文章最后提供可落地的实施路径,并指出未来在自主AI系统日益普及背景下的研究方向。
原文摘要 · Abstract (English)
The modern enterprise is facing an unprecedented surge in digital identities, with machine identities now significantly outnumbering human identities. This paper examines the cybersecurity risks emerging from what we define as the "human-machine identity blur" - the point at which human and machine identities intersect, delegate authority, and create new attack surfaces. Drawing from industry data, expert insights, and real-world incident analysis, we identify key governance gaps in current identity management models that treat human and machine entities as separate domains. To address these challenges, we propose a Unified Identity Governance Framework based on four core principles: treating identity as a continuum rather than a binary distinction, applying consistent risk evaluation across all identity types, implementing continuous verification guided by zero trust principles, and maintaining governance throughout the entire identity lifecycle. Our research shows that organizations adopting this unified approach experience a 47 percent reduction in identity-related security incidents and a 62 percent improvement in incident response time. We conclude by offering a practical implementation roadmap and outlining future research directions as AI-driven systems become increasingly autonomous.
